Kenneth Benter 1926-2004

Kenneth Benter, 77, died Monday evening, Jan. 5, 2004, in St. Luke's Hospital, Cedar Rapids, following an extended illness. Services: 11 a.m. Thursday, St. John's Lutheran Church, Hopkinton. Burial: Hopkinton Cemetery. Friends may call after 10 a.m. Thursday morning at the church. Arrangements by Goettsch Funeral Home, Monticello.

Survivors include a brother, Irvin (Vivien) Benter of Monticello; two sisters, Janelle Knockle of Marion and Selma (Glenn) Welshhons of Cedar Rapids.

He was preceded in death by his parents and a brother, Arlan.

Kenneth Benter was born June 19, 1926, near Hopkinton. He was the son of Fred and Mary Kurth Benter. Kenneth graduated from the Hopkinton Community Schools in 1943. Kenneth was employed by the U.S. Postal Service for 38 years in Hopkinton. He retired in 1990. Ken was a lifelong member of St. John's Lutheran Church. /tx

Gazette, The (Cedar Rapids-Iowa City, IA) - Wednesday, January 7, 2004
